Do the new X38 boards offer much of an advantage over P35 types?

Nope they don't.

Benchmarks show that synthetic benchmarks are hardly anything to write home about over P35. The extra PCI-E lanes don't seem to do much either, I read on XS that one LN2 bencher didn't find crossfire any faster but that might be the case because more PCI-E bandwidth doesn't show much improvement unless used at massive resolutions (which stock benchmarks such as 3DMark are not).

X38 can handle DDR3 better by the looks but with the price of DDR at the moment, seems like a null point to make. I think PCI-E lanes is the only benefit for me because I want to invest in a good raid controller card.
